Contractual Longevity and Institutional Leverage
By securing Prestianni until June 30, 2029, Benfica has effectively insulated the player from predatory transfer attempts. This five-year outlook provides the club with significant leverage in any future negotiations.
In the modern football economy, the length of a contract is often as valuable as the player’s skill set, as it dictates the “remaining book value” and the premium required to break the agreement.

Strategic Institutional Context: Why Benfica?
To understand Prestianni’s net worth trajectory, one must analyze the business model of his employer. SL Benfica operates as a high-level intermediary in the football value chain.
They acquire elite South American talent, provide exposure to European competition, and eventually sell to “end-destination” clubs (typically in the English Premier League or Spanish La Liga).
For Prestianni, this means his current €14 million valuation is likely the “floor” for his future sale. If he maintains his current development curve, the “exit price” could easily double or triple before 2029, particularly if he becomes a mainstay in the Argentine national setup.

The Argentine Talent Pipeline: A Macroeconomic View
Prestianni’s move to Benfica is part of a broader trend of Argentine “exports” that drive the national football economy.
Before his move to Portugal, Prestianni was the subject of intense interest from major European clubs, which served as the primary catalyst for his high initial valuation.
The “Velez Sarsfield” school of development, where Prestianni originated, has a reputation for producing technically proficient and mentally resilient players.
This pedigree acts as a form of “quality assurance” for European scouts, justifying the multi-million euro investment required to secure his signature.
